      He guys. Another error log after raspberry startup. Maybe helps?

      pi@raspberrypi:~ $ npm start dev
      npm ERR! Linux 4.4.26-v7+
      npm ERR! argv "/usr/bin/nodejs" "/usr/bin/npm" "start" "dev"
      npm ERR! node v6.9.1
      npm ERR! npm  v3.10.8
      npm ERR! path /home/pi/package.json
      npm ERR! code ENOENT
      npm ERR! errno -2
      npm ERR! syscall open
      
      npm ERR! enoent ENOENT: no such file or directory, open '/home/pi/package.json'
      npm ERR! enoent ENOENT: no such file or directory, open '/home/pi/package.json'
      npm ERR! enoent This is most likely not a problem with npm itself
      npm ERR! enoent and is related to npm not being able to find a file.
      npm ERR! enoent
      
      npm ERR! Please include the following file with any support request:
      npm ERR!     /home/pi/npm-debug.log
      
      
      yawnsY 1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
      • yawnsY Offline
        yawns Moderator @FlorianRD
        last edited by

        @FlorianRD
        you are in the wrong directory.

        cd MagicMirror
        npm start dev
